If you get ME-TV then check the time for the Route 66 episode Lizard's Leg and Owlet's Wing on Saturday, November 1, 2014. It has Boris Karloff, Peter Lorre and Lon Chaney, Jr. as the special guests!

That was a nice touch of having Vincent price do the voice of the Invisible Man in A&CMF.
He played the IM in the 1940 movie The Invisible Man Returns. |
